Responsibility:
- Developing user-facing applications using Vue.js.
- Building modular and reusable components and libraries.
- Developing and implementing highly responsive user interface components.
- Meeting with the development team to discuss user interface ideas and applications.
- Optimising your application for performance.
- Implementing automated testing integrated into development and maintenance workflows.
- Keeping an eye on security updates and issues found with Vue.js and all project dependencies
Qualifications:
- At least 2 years of experience with Vue.js.
- Highly proficient with the JavaScript language and its modern ES6+ syntax and features.
- Highly proficient with Vue.js framework and its core principles such as components, reactivity, and the virtual DOM.
- Familiarity with the Vue.js ecosystem, including Vue CLI, Vite, Pinia, Vue Router, and Nuxt.js.
- Good understanding of HTML5 and CSS3, including Sass, MUI, TailwindCSS.
- Familiarity with automated JavaScript testing, specifically testing frameworks such as Jest, Vitest or Mocha.
- Familiarity with end-to-end testing such as Cypress or Katalon.
- Proficiency with modern development tools, like Babel, Webpack, ESBuild and Git.
- Experience with consuming RESTful APIs or GraphQL.
- Experience with Progressive Web App development.
- Experience with mobile apps development is not mandatory but a big plus
-Hybrid (4 WFO & 1 WFH)
Skills- React.js
- RESTful Services
- REST APIs
- Vue.js
- APIs
At Lion Parcel, we are collaborative, fast paced, innovative, open and progressive.
Benefits and perks of working with us include:
Compensation: Competitive salaries
Family benefits: Paid maternity / paternity leave
Lifestyle: Casual dress code, Company outings, Flexible hours, Free food, Hybrid
Progression: Professional development
Welfare: Employee discounts, Health insurance, Paid sick days